G AND YAW RATE SENSOR CALIBRATION




caution If the work below is done, finally calibrate the G and yaw rate sensor. This is necessary because the ASTC-ECU should update the G and yaw rate sensor neutral point.

  • G and yaw rate sensor replacement
  • ASTC-ECU replacement



  1. Park the vehicle on a level surface.
  2. caution Before connecting or disconnecting the M.U.T.-III, turn the ignition switch to the "LOCK" (OFF) position.
    Connect M.U.T.-III to the 16-pin diagnosis connector.
  3. Turn the ignition switch to the "ON" position.
  4. Select "Interactive Diagnosis".
  5. Select "Special function".
  6. Select "G and yaw rate sensor".
  7. Select "Calibration".
  8. Turn the ignition switch to the "LOCK" (OFF) position.
  9. Disconnect M.U.T.-III.
